Khalid and K-pop group BTS have a new project in the works.

In a radio interview with 102.7 KIIS-FM Los Angeles, the mega-popular South Korean super group revealed that they have been collaborating with the “Free Spirit” singer. When asked about who they would like to link up with, RM replied, "I have to mention Khalid... Our friend. It is really happening. So please stay tuned to our Khalid collaboration."

Most recently BTS has worked with Halsey for “Boy With Luv.” The music video has already racked up 238 million views on YouTube in the month since it was released.
